    [Research] "Hardcore" in mobile games

    Posted: 08 Aug 2020 05:23 AM PDT

    Hey, I am a game developer on mobile games, to be precise, a games designer.

    Just wanted to hear some ideas. What do you think about "Hardcore" elements in moible games?

    The reason of the question is that whenever someone mentions that word in a mobile game studio, people first word is "No no no no no, we need to make it casual and accessible as if it was a 3 year old game"

    But the reality is that one of the most popular genres, Battle Royales, is basically a game where 1 player wins, 99 players lose.
    Isn't this... hardcore?

    What do you guys think about having a game like "Escape from Tarkov" (a PC game where you bring to Raids some of the gear you have collected and try to escape) which basically is a multiplayer with the Minecraft mechanic, that if you die, you loose all the current gear you are wearing?
